Spider-Man: Homecoming looks to be on the better end of that spectrum.  And although I enjoy seeing Tony Stark in movies, I have to wonder if his presence here will make this feel less like a true solo Spider-Man film.

As for what this movie is about, the villain is the Vulture, and I know almost nothing about him so I can't say.  But the trailers focus a lot on the mentoring relationship between Tony Stark and Peter Parker.  That was a big hit in last year's Captain America: Civil War, so I see no reason to worry about this movie being entertaining.

Spider-Man: Homecoming is rated PG-13 for sci-fi action violence, some language and brief suggestive comments.
